Le Bourreau turc (1904)
Submitted by buak
AKA: The Terrible Turkish Executioner
Summary: In a public place in Constantinople at the corner of a bazaar, the executioner is seated upon a stone and is resting from his daily labors while eating a crust of bread. Suddenly there come running into the place a lot of Turkish men and women preceding some Turkish policemen, who drag along four prisoners in chains. The policemen shut up the four prisoners in the pillory. (imdb)
Country: France
Directed By: Georges Méliès
Starring: Georges Méliès
